如何为Google Chrome启用自动登录用户身份验证

dav*_*mcd 42 windows asp.net internet-explorer ntlm google-chrome

我有一个网站,我允许我使用我的信用卡(Windows)自动登录并使用Internet Explorer我可以将"用户身份验证"下的选项设置为"使用当前用户名和密码自动登录",但我'我想使用谷歌浏览器.但是,它总是提示我用户/通行证,我希望它像IE一样设置.任何人都知道这是否可行?谢谢!

dav*_*mcd 36

如果您将站点添加到"本地Intranet"中

Chrome > Options > Under the Hood > Change Proxy Settings > Security (tab) > Local Intranet/Sites > Advanced.

在这里添加您的网站URL,它将工作.

新版Chrome更新

Chrome > Settings > Advanced > Open Proxy Settings > Security (tab) > Local Intranet > Sites (button) > Advanced.

  • 为了使其工作,在我将站点添加到本地Intranet区域后,我不得不在Internet Explorer中访问该站点,并在那里保存我的凭据.然后Chrome按照此答案中的说明工作. (3认同)

Max*_*ime 27

自问这个问题以来,Chrome确实更改了菜单.使用Chrome 47.0.2526.7372.0.3626.109测试该解决方案.

如果您现在正在使用Chrome,则可以使用以下命令检查您的版本:chrome:// version

  1. 转到:chrome://设置

  1. 向下滚动到页面底部,然后单击"高级"以显示更多设置.

旧版本:

向下滚动到页面底部,然后单击"显示高级设置..."以显示更多设置.

  1. 在"系统"部分中,单击"打开代理设置".

旧版本:

在"网络"部分中,单击"更改代理设置...".

  1. 单击"安全"选项卡,然后选择"本地Intranet"图标并单击"站点"按钮.

  1. 单击"高级"按钮.

  1. 插入Intranet本地地址,然后单击"添加"按钮.

  1. 关闭所有窗户.

而已.

  • 请注意,这是*IE的*网络对话框,而不是Chrome的.Chrome使用与IE相同的设置 (7认同)
  • 并非为我解决,而是赞成明确的指示 (2认同)

bbo*_*ler 16

虽然moopasta的答案有效,但它似乎不允许使用通配符,还有另一种(可能更好的)选项.Chromium项目有一些有用但不完整的HTTP身份验证文档.

特别是我发现最好的选项是将您希望允许Chrome传递身份验证信息的网站列入白名单,您可以通过以下方式执行此操作:

  • 使用auth-server-whitelist命令行开关启动Chrome .例如--auth-server-whitelist="*example.com,*foobar.com,*baz".这种方法的缺点是,打开其他程序的链接将启动Chrome而无需命令行开关.
  • 安装,启用和配置AuthServerWhitelist/"身份验证服务器白名单"组策略或本地组策略.这似乎是最稳定的选项,但需要更多的工作来设置.您可以在本地进行设置,无需远程部署.

那些希望为企业设置此功能的人可能会遵循使用组策略管理控制台来配置AuthServerWhitelist策略的说明.那些希望仅针对一台机器进行设置的人也可以遵循组策略说明:

  1. 下载并解压缩最新的Chrome策略模板
  2. Start > Run > gpedit.msc
  3. 导航 Local Computer Policy > Computer Configuration > Administrative Templates
  4. 单击鼠标右键Administrative Templates,然后选择Add/Remove Templates
  5. windows\adm\en-US\chrome.adm通过对话框添加模板
  6. Computer Configuration > Administrative Templates > Classic Administrative Templates > Google > Google Chrome > Policies for HTTP Authentication启用和配置中Authentication server whitelist
  7. 重新启动Chrome并导航chrome://policy至查看有效政策

  • [本文](http://blogs.specopssoft.com/2014/06/configuring-chrome-and-firefox-for.html)介绍了如果不想使用GP或命令时如何向注册表添加值开关。基本上在“ HKLM \ Software \ Policies \ Google \ Chrome \ AuthServerWhitelist”下添加AuthServerWhitelist(string):“ * example.com,* foobar.com,* baz”。在我的情况下,令人讨厌的是,我的基础架构人员使用具有1个单服务器的GP添加了此功能,这导致_everyother_Intranet网站提示我。删除此键可解决问题 (2认同)